WWE Champion Randy Orton vs. John Cena (Anything Goes Iron Man Match)
One night after Randy Orton won the WWE Championship back within Satan’s Structure at Hell in a Cell, The Viper accepted John Cena’s challenge to defend his gold at WWE Bragging Rights in a 60-minute Anything Goes Iron Man Match.
With the modification that there will be no disqualifications and no count-outs in their WWE Bragging Rights bout, the two men will tear into each other trying to accumulate as many pinfalls and submissions in the allotted time. The man with the most decisions in the end will be declared the victor and walk out as WWE Champion in what both men have agreed to be their final battle – meaning no rematch for either man no matter what happens and if Cena loses, he must leave Raw.
For months, Cena and Orton have waged war, and what the WWE Iron Man Match will do is take the hatred both these men have for each other, and use it to determine a decisive winner between the two.
Already having faced one another in a series of bouts including an “I Quit” Match and a Hell in a Cell Match this year, these men have become quite familiar with one another in the ring. Though Orton has prevailed in three out of four of the aforementioned bouts, throughout their storied careers, the two men hold a 5-5 record against one another in all-time pay-per-view matches.
To date, the WWE Iron Man Match has only come into play a handful of times, including the classic match-up pitting Shawn Michaels against Bret Hart at WrestleMania XII. As any man who has done battle in one of these legendary bouts can tell you, this ultimate test of endurance is not for the faint of heart.

World Heavyweight Champion The Undertaker vs. CM Punk vs. Batista vs. Rey Mysterio (Fatal-4-Way Match)
At WWE Bragging Rights, new World Heavyweight Champion The Undertaker will defend his title in a Fatal-4-Way Match against three former Word Champions: CM Punk, Rey Mysterio and Batista.

The Deadman defeated CM Punk inside The Devil’s Playground at Hell in a Cell to win his seventh World Title. Five days later, The Straightedge Superstar stormed his way into Friday night, demanding that SmackDown General Manager Theodore Long give him his mandatory rematch on his terms. But before the issue could be resolved, Mr. McMahon emerged to “help” Long make “his” monumental announcement – the former Straightedge Champion’s rematch would be a Fatal-4-Way at WWE Bragging Rights, and it would also include The Master of the 619 and The Animal.

With his most recent acquisition of the gold, The Phenom has arguably transcended other SmackDown Superstars to reach a level of competition all his own. The Undertaker’s reputation has become as intimidating as his deadly arsenal of weapons. And now that he holds the World Title as his “holy grail,” is it conceivable that any Superstar will ever overcome his wrath?

However, in a Fatal-4-Way the odds are against The Undertaker. And because he does not have to be pinned to lose his championship, the fate of the World Title could ultimately end up out of his control.
